FAQ |
Kalender |
![]() |
#41 | ||
|
|||
Medlem
|
Citat:
Kod:
display: table-cell; vertical-align: middle; |
||
![]() |
![]() |
![]() |
#42 | ||
|
|||
Har WN som tidsfördriv
|
Citat:
header("Content-Type: text/css"); ?> |
||
![]() |
![]() |
![]() |
#43 | ||
|
|||
Medlem
|
Citat:
<!--QuoteBegin--KarlRoos[/i] <?php header("Content-Type: text/css"); ?> [/quote] jo, men hur inkluderar man den CSS:en i just den HTML-filen? Blir det något i stil med: Kod:
<link type="text/css" href="includes/galleryCSS.php?sammagetstringsomHTMLsidanhar" rel="stylesheet" media="screen" /> |
||
![]() |
![]() |
![]() |
#44 | ||
|
|||
Har WN som tidsfördriv
|
Citat:
|
||
![]() |
![]() |
![]() |
#45 | ||
|
|||
Medlem
|
Citat:
![]() |
||
![]() |
![]() |
![]() |
#46 | |||
|
||||
Flitig postare
|
Hej,
Jag har ett problem som jag inte lyckats lösa med div's som kanske någon av er som är duktiga på css och sånt kan lösa. Jag har en sida med tre divar bredvid varandra; left, content, right. Där left och right bara innehåller en bakgrundsbild som repeteras. Content kan vara olika hög på olika sidor, så att sätta en height funkar liksom inte. När jag kör IE så ser sidan bra ut, divarna left och right anpassar sig till rätt höjd, men i FF så ser man bara en bild, dvs bilden autoanpassas inte höjdmässigt till content. Hur fixar man detta? |
|||
![]() |
![]() |
![]() |
#47 | ||
|
|||
Klarade millennium-buggen
|
googla på faux columns
snabbt förklarat så har man en bakgrundbild i föräldradivven (wrapper) till dina tre övriga divvar. Kod:
<div id="wrapper"> <div id="left">innehålll</div> <div id="middle">innehålll</div> <div id="right">innehålll</div> </div> |
||
![]() |
![]() |
![]() |
#48 | |||
|
||||
Flitig postare
|
aha, så istället för att dela upp sin bakgrund i tre delar left.jpg, content.jpg och right.jpg, så gör man en bg.jpg som är lika bred som själva sidan och sen kör man den i wrapper? kanonsmart, tack för hjälpen.
|
|||
![]() |
![]() |
![]() |
#49 | ||
|
|||
Klarade millennium-buggen
|
spot on!
|
||
![]() |
![]() |
![]() |
#50 | |||
|
||||
Klarade millennium-buggen
|
Folk som nämner "semantisk html" och "div" i samma mening inser knappast tankevurpan.
Folk som tycker "css" är motsatsen till "tabeller" har också en läxa att läsa på. Html (eller snarare xhtml) och css ska ses som två lager: en databärare och ett presentationslager. Att jämföra dessa är som att jämföra äpplen och päron. Och för de som är för semantiskt korrekt html och ser på detta som en religion vet att dom samtidigt måste vara otrogna varje gång de designar en sida då de använder exempelvis div'ar ENDAST i layoutsyfte, dvs de styr layouten från html-koden. Detta är ju den begränsning vi alla får leva med då CSS i dagsläget inte klarar av att helt axla ansvaret att sköta all layout. En sann databärare är ju XML, men det är inte det lättaste att få till snyggt på en klient... Tills den dagen kommer så får vi stå ut med en soppa av nästlade div'ar blandat med semantisk korrekt html. För mig skulle dessa div'ar lika gärna kunna vara en tabell, det är liksom lika fel, men jag håller mig till containrar av modellen div då jag tror på framtiden... ![]() |
|||
![]() |
![]() |
Svara |
|
|